Common Causes of BTS6143D Connectivity Issues:
Interference from Other Devices: Bluetooth operates on the 2.4 GHz frequency, which can sometimes conflict with other wireless devices, such as Wi-Fi routers, microwaves, or other Bluetooth devices nearby. Outdated Firmware or Drivers : If the firmware or Drivers of your BTS6143D are outdated, it can lead to connectivity issues. This is especially true if the device hasn’t been updated in a while. Distance or Obstructions: Bluetooth devices work best within a certain range. If you're too far from the paired device or if there are walls and other physical obstructions in the way, you might experience connection drops. Software or App Conflicts: Sometimes, apps or other software running on your device might cause Bluetooth connectivity problems by interfering with the signal or using the Bluetooth connection simultaneously. Pairing Issues: If your device has been previously paired with multiple devices, it might be having trouble connecting to a new one or reconnecting to the previous one.Step-by-Step Troubleshooting for BTS6143D Connectivity Issues:
Step 1: Check Bluetooth Settings and Ensure Device Visibility
Action: Open the Bluetooth settings on the device you're connecting to (e.g., a smartphone, laptop, or PC). Make sure Bluetooth is turned on, and that the BTS6143D is set to be visible or discoverable. Why: If the BTS6143D isn't visible to the other device, it won’t be able to connect.Step 2: Move Closer to the Device
Action: Ensure that the BTS6143D and the connected device are within Bluetooth range (typically about 30 feet, depending on the device). Remove any walls or obstacles that might be blocking the signal. Why: Bluetooth performance drops significantly with distance or obstructions.Step 3: Remove Other Wireless Interference
Action: Turn off other devices that might be interfering with the Bluetooth signal, such as nearby Wi-Fi routers, cordless phones, or other Bluetooth gadgets. Why: Wireless interference can cause unstable or weak Bluetooth connections.Step 4: Restart Both Devices
Action: Power off both the BTS6143D and the device you're trying to connect to. Wait for a few seconds and power them back on. Then try to reconnect. Why: Sometimes, a simple restart can fix temporary connectivity issues by resetting the devices' Bluetooth module s.Step 5: Update Firmware and Drivers
Action: Visit the manufacturer's website or check the device's app (if applicable) for any firmware or driver updates. Follow the instructions to download and install the latest versions. Why: Outdated firmware or drivers can lead to compatibility issues, causing connectivity problems.Step 6: Forget and Re-pair the Device
Action: On the device you're connecting to, go to the Bluetooth settings, find the BTS6143D, and choose "Forget" or "Remove." Then, try pairing the device again by searching for it in the Bluetooth settings. Why: Sometimes, the Bluetooth pairing information can get corrupted. Forgetting the device and re-pairing it can resolve this.Step 7: Check for Software Conflicts
Action: If you're using a laptop or smartphone, make sure no other apps are using Bluetooth at the same time. Close any unnecessary applications that may interfere with the Bluetooth connection. Why: Other apps or services might be monopolizing the Bluetooth connection, causing it to drop or fail to establish.Step 8: Reset the BTS6143D (Factory Reset)
Action: If all else fails, you can reset the BTS6143D to factory settings. Look for the reset button or follow the instructions in the user manual to reset the device. Why: A factory reset can clear any internal settings or configurations that might be causing issues and give the device a fresh start.Additional Tips:
Try Different Devices: If possible, try connecting the BTS6143D to a different smartphone, laptop, or PC to see if the issue persists. This can help rule out whether the problem lies with the BTS6143D or the device you are trying to connect to. Check for Compatibility: Ensure that the BTS6143D is compatible with the Bluetooth version of your device.
